Experience a vivid voyage along the Normandy coast, told with wit, warmth, and a sense of place.
In this travel memoir, readers follow a memorable journey to Villerville and beyond, where inns by the sea become stages for social observation, humor, and small adventures. The narrator sketches seaside life, coastal moods, and the charm of old inns, all while capturing the character and charm of notable travelers and locals alike. This edition invites you to step into 19th-century travel, dining rooms, and harbor towns through a lively, companionable voice.
